Responsibilities
- Supports the HR Business Partner in areas including Talent management and Retention, Compensation, Performance planning, Rewards & Recognition, Benefits, Employee relations, and Local Labor Law compliance.
- Provides HR support to India employees by working closely with managers, employees, and/or other parties in order to implement and manage the HR function.
- Formulates and administers HR Policies benchmarked to India region for Compensation and Benefits, Performance Planning, Rewards and Recognition, and other India Labor law related compliance.
- Manage the HR activities related to employee life cycle - onboarding, probation period management, talent management, and employee exit processes.
- Coordinates payroll processes and audits payroll inputs prior to accepting and submitting to payroll provider.
- Oversees and manages leave administration for all India employees.
- Works closely with service providers for payroll, leave, and benefits enrollment and administration.
- Advises and educates managers in all the relevant areas of Indian employment law.
- Provides quality administrative and project support, ensuring tasks are accurately completed within specified timeframes by working with department managers, employees, vendors, subcontractors, and others.
- Coordinates employee activities, training sessions, meetings, and holiday events as needed.
Requirements
- HR generalist experience in India
- Demonstrated knowledge of employment law and ability to apply them to current business situations.
- Thorough knowledge of HR principles and best practices.
- Extensive knowledge of computer systems with proficiency in Google products
- High standard of ethics and integrity along with experience maintaining confidentiality, including integrity and security of computer systems, files, and data.
- Strong analytical skills and aptitude for math and numbers in order to audit payroll and benefits, proofread documents, conduct research, and develop HR metrics.
- Well developed interpersonal and persuasive skills with the ability to interact and influence across all levels of the organization.
- Strong organizational skills and the ability to work in a fast-paced, changing environment managing multiple priorities.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Well-developed presentation skills.

We are seeking an HR Generalist to take on a comprehensive role, supporting all aspects of Human Resources for our India-based employees. This position reports to the HR Business Partner and is a direct result of recent headcount expansion within the India team. This role requires at least three days in-office attendance at our Hyderabad location. Candidates who cannot meet this requirement will not be considered.
